Web23 Sep 2024 · The findings: From 2010 to 2012, the credit score threshold for most mortgage lenders shifted toward buyers with better credit scores. In 2010, the authors show, there were few loans made to applicants with credit scores below 620. By 2012, the minimum credit score that lenders would be likely to accept rose to 640.

WebCredit scoring is a widely used way to assess the risk of lending money to people. However, no-one has a single credit score. As well as scores produced by Experian and the other main credit reference agencies, many lenders also calculate their own credit scores in house. This means you will have multiple credit scores.
